Analysis# Jordan Unemployment Rate Jordan's unemployment rate stands at 22% in 2023, reflecting a labor market under persistent strain. The current level sits significantly below the all-time peak of 24.1% recorded in 2021 but remains extraordinarily elevated compared to the historical low of 5.4% in 1984. Over the four-decade span from 1984 to 2023, unemployment has risen 307.4%, marking a dramatic structural shift in Jordan's employment landscape. The most striking trend emerges from 2014 onward, when the rate accelerated sharply from 11.9% to 24.1% by 2021—a seven-year climb driven by regional instability, refugee influx, and economic pressures. A modest recovery began in 2022, declining to 22.9%, with 2023 showing a further slight improvement to 22%. Despite this recent moderation, joblessness remains well above pre-2014 levels, suggesting structural challenges requiring sustained policy intervention.
